STAT 656 - Statistical Computing

Institution:
Slippery Rock University of Pennsylvania
Subject:
Description:
Computational data analysis is an essential part of modern statistics. Topics concerning computing and advanced statistics will be covered. Statistical analysis packages (such as SAS, R, and SPSS) will be discussed and compared. Background information and computational issues in various areas of statistics will be included.
